Abstract
We present a possible explanation of the recently observed 511 keV -ray anomaly with a new ``millicharged'' fermion. The new fermion is light () but has never been observed by any collider experiments mainly because of its tiny electromagnetic charge . We show that constraints from its relic density in the Universe and collider experiments allow a parameter range such that the 511 keV cosmic -ray emission from the galactic bulge may be due to positron production from this millicharged fermion.
